CAMPUS SUMMARY
At Massachusetts College of Liberal Arts (MCLA) we believe a college education should offer you the experiential curriculum that provides the unique path and vital tools to get you where you want to be in life. To help you succeed, we believe your liberal arts education should be wide-ranging and practical.
MCLA prides itself on an ideal student/faculty ratio of approximately 14:1 which fosters personal attention, quality teaching, and in-depth learning.
MCLA is located in North Adams, Massachusetts, 1 mile from the downtown area of 15,000, in the northwestern corner of the state, bordering both Vermont and New York.


UNIQUE/SPECIAL PROGRAMS
MCLA is the public liberal arts college of Massachusetts, offering Bachelor of Arts, Bachelor of Science, and Master of Education degrees. The college has 35 programs, 14 departmental majors, 26 minors and four levels of teacher certification.
Undergraduate programs are offered in biology, business administration, computer science, education, English/communications, environmental studies, fine and performing arts, history, interdisciplinary studies, mathematics, philosophy, physics, psychology and sociology.
